In The Media

In 1989, Jodi Hernandez was part of a group of reporters that investigated the Aggressive Christians from March to September through KOVR-TV, CBS channel 13 Sacramento. Disturbing revelations were made of alleged treatment by the Greens against children and adults. These were graphically described by former members in this report.

In December 1999, Darren White, former secretary of the Department of Public Safety for New Mexico, and then reporter for KRQE, CBS channel 13, Albuquerque, reported on the Greens.

On November 4, 2005, Jim Maniaci, of the Gallup Independent's Cibola County Bureau in Grants, reported on the co-leader of an isolated religious group who was jailed on an aggravated battery with a deadly weapon charge named Jim Green. The article reported that Green was booked into the Cibola County Detention Center on October 29 after an altercation with two other men at the Shim Ra Na Holy Tribal Nation farm near Fence Lake in the rural southwestern portion of the county.

In June, 2006, Annie McCormick of KRQE, CBS channel 13, Albuquerque, NM, also investigated the Greens using first hand reports from former members and families.
